New Delhi: The Congress Central Election Committee (CEC) meeting was held in view of the Madhya Pradesh assembly polls at the AICC (All India Congress Committee) headquarters in Delhi on Friday. Party President Mallikarjun Kharge chaired the meeting.

Former Congress chief Rahul Gandhi, Adhir Ranjan Chowdhury, Ambika Soni, MP Congress chief Kamal Nath and several other leaders were present during the meeting.

According to the sources, the Congress is likely to finalise the first list of around 140 candidates for the forthcoming assembly polls in the meeting and the list is likely to be released on Sunday. After the CEC meeting, a screening committee meeting of the party will also be held for discussion on the remaining names of the candidates for the assembly polls.

Madhya Pradesh is scheduled to undergo assembly polls on November 17 for 230 Assembly constituencies. The counting would be done on December 3. (with Agency inputs)
